The Fault Line: Who Sells the Buildout vs. Who Pays for It
For roughly three years, "AI" functioned as a single directional bet. You bought exposure — chips, cloud, software, power — and the correlation did the rest. Names that had almost nothing to do with each other operationally traded like they were the same security, because they were all being priced off the same story.
That correlation broke yesterday, and it broke cleanly.
On one side: Micron up about 4%. Applied Materials up more than 5%. Lam Research higher. Taiwan Semiconductor higher.
On the other: Microsoft down roughly 3%. Oracle down more than 2.5%.
This was not a tech selloff. If capital were fleeing AI as a theme, the equipment makers would have been hit hardest — they are the highest-beta expression of the trade. Instead they led. Money didn't leave the sector. It moved down the stack, out of the companies buying AI infrastructure and into the companies selling it.
That distinction is the whole story, and most coverage will miss it because the index level looked unremarkable.
Why Memory Chip Prices Became the Trigger
Memory prices have been climbing hard for months, and Monday delivered another push.
Commerce Secretary Howard Lutnick told the Wall Street Journal that the administration opposes Apple purchasing Chinese memory chips. Read that in market terms rather than political terms: a large, price-insensitive buyer is being pushed out of one of the few supply pools outside the incumbent Western and Korean producers. That demand doesn't disappear. It gets redirected onto the remaining suppliers — Micron among them — in a market that was already tight.
This is the part worth slowing down on, because it determines how long the move lasts.
There are two ways prices rise. In a demand shock, buyers get richer or hungrier and bid prices up — but the price signal eventually pulls new supply online, and the move self-corrects. In a supply shock, the available pool shrinks while demand stays put. Prices rise not because anyone wants more, but because there is less to go around.
What's happening in memory is structurally a supply shock, and it's a policy-driven one. That matters because policy-driven supply constraints don't respond to price the way ordinary shortages do. Micron can't simply run the fabs harder to capture the spread — leading-edge memory capacity takes years and enormous capital to add, and no one is going to commit that capital on the assumption that an export restriction is permanent. The shortage persists precisely because the fix is slow and the cause is political.
Supply shocks don't destroy margin. They transfer it — from the buyers of the constrained input to the sellers of it. Yesterday's tape was that transfer happening in real time.
Memory Isn't a Product. It's a Cost Line.
Here's the piece the headlines keep getting wrong.
When memory prices rise, the market reflexively frames it as good news for chip stocks. It is. But memory is not a finished product sold to consumers. It is an input — one of the largest single line items in an AI server, and the one with the least room to engineer around.
Every company building AI data centers has to buy it. Microsoft has to buy it. Oracle has to buy it. Meta, Amazon, and every neocloud with a GPU order has to buy it. There is no substitution on a quarterly timeline. You cannot redesign around a memory shortage the way you can renegotiate a logistics contract or slow hiring. Server architectures are locked 18 to 24 months before deployment, and high-bandwidth memory has no functional replacement in an accelerator.
So the same headline that lifts Micron is a margin warning for everyone downstream of Micron. That's why Microsoft fell 3% on a day with no Microsoft news.
And there's a second-order effect that compounds it. Data center hardware isn't expensed in the quarter it's purchased — it's capitalized and depreciated over roughly five to six years. Which means memory bought at today's inflated prices doesn't produce a one-quarter earnings dent. It locks a higher cost basis into the income statement for half a decade. Every dollar of overpriced DRAM purchased in 2026 shows up as depreciation drag through 2031.
That's the difference between a bad quarter and a structurally lower return on invested capital. The market is beginning to price the second one.
Operating Leverage Runs Both Ways
The asymmetry in yesterday's move comes down to operating leverage — and it's worth understanding why the reaction was so sharp on both ends.
Micron's cost base is dominated by fixed costs: fabs, equipment, depreciation. Those costs are roughly the same whether prices are high or low. So when memory pricing rises, an outsized share of the incremental revenue falls straight to the bottom line. A modest move in average selling prices can produce a dramatic move in earnings. That's why memory names trade with such violent amplitude in both directions.
Now flip it. The hyperscalers have the same dynamic in reverse. Their AI revenue is still ramping while the capex commitments are already made. Rising input costs land on a fixed revenue base, and the depreciation schedule I just described means they can't flex the cost down even if they wanted to.
The equipment makers — Applied Materials, Lam Research — sit in the best seat of all. They don't sell memory, so they don't carry commodity price risk. They sell the tools required to make more of it. A structural shortage is the single strongest signal that capacity expansion is coming, and capacity expansion is their revenue. Applied Materials gaining more than 5% while the buyers of AI infrastructure fell wasn't a coincidence. It was the market correctly identifying who collects the toll.
The Second Squeeze: Financing Just Got More Expensive
If input costs were the only pressure, this would be a manageable story. They aren't.
The 30-year Treasury yield closed at 5.31%, the highest level of 2026.
AI data centers are not funded out of quarterly cash flow. They are funded with debt, and increasingly with structured and off-balance-sheet vehicles designed specifically to finance long-lived infrastructure. The long end of the curve is the reference rate for that financing. When the 30-year moves, the cost of capital for every project still on the drawing board moves with it.
So the squeeze is happening from both sides at once. The equipment costs more, and the money to buy the equipment costs more.
There's a valuation mechanism layered on top of that, and it's the one that does the most damage to share prices. A hyperscaler's stock price is a discounted stream of future cash flows, weighted heavily toward cash flows that arrive years from now. Rising long-end yields raise the discount rate applied to those distant cash flows — and long-duration assets are the most sensitive to that adjustment. Meanwhile, rising memory costs are shrinking the cash flows being discounted.
Numerator down. Denominator up. Both moving the wrong way in the same session. That's the mathematical explanation for why $112 billion of Microsoft's market value evaporated on a day when nothing happened at Microsoft.
This Morning's Setup
That pressure carried straight into the overnight session.
Nasdaq 100 futures are down about 1.1%, with bond yields and oil both climbing.
Note the combination, because it constrains the possible explanations. Equities falling with yields rising is not a growth-scare pattern — in a growth scare, money flows into Treasuries and yields fall. This is the opposite: capital is repricing the cost of money, not the trajectory of the economy. Oil climbing at the same time reinforces it, since firm energy prices feed directly into the inflation expectations embedded in the long end.
This is a cost-of-capital move, not a demand move. Different problem, different playbook, different resolution path.
Wednesday Is the Actual Catalyst
Everything above sets up the event that matters this week.
The Federal Reserve releases the minutes from its July meeting on Wednesday. Three officials dissented at that meeting because they wanted a rate hike.
Sit with that for a moment, because it inverts the assumption most portfolios are built on. The consensus positioning across risk assets assumes the next move in rates is down, and the only live question is timing. Three dissents in the hawkish direction says the internal debate is not about how fast to cut. It's about whether the Fed is finished tightening at all.
The minutes will tell investors how close that vote actually was — whether those three were isolated outliers or the visible edge of a larger faction that didn't formally dissent but shared the concern. That's the specific detail markets will parse.
The stakes tie directly back to everything above. If the minutes read more hawkish than expected, long-end yields have further room to run, financing costs for the AI buildout rise again, and the pressure on the capex spenders intensifies. If they read softer, the discount-rate half of the squeeze eases — though the memory cost problem stays exactly where it is, because that one is being driven by trade policy, not monetary policy.
That's the key asymmetry to hold onto: the Fed can relieve one of these two pressures. It cannot relieve both.
What This Means for How You Position
The instinct after a session like this is to pick a winner and chase it. Resist it. The more useful exercise is to look at your holdings and answer one question for each: is this company selling the AI buildout, or paying for it?
That single question now separates outcomes better than sector labels do. "Tech" is no longer a coherent exposure. A semiconductor equipment maker and a hyperscaler are on opposite sides of the same cost curve, and owning both is not diversification — it's a hedge you didn't intend to place.
A few things worth watching from here:
Does memory pricing hold through the next contract cycle? Spot moves are noisy. Contract pricing is what actually flows into earnings.
Do the hyperscalers signal any capex discipline? Rising costs plus rising financing rates create real pressure to slow the pace. Any hint of that would reprice both sides of this trade at once.
Does the 30-year hold above 5%? That level is doing more to determine AI infrastructure economics right now than any individual earnings report.
Rotations like this one are how markets mature a theme. The first phase prices the story. The second phase prices the economics. We are watching the handoff in real time — and the companies that were carried by narrative are now being asked to show the math.
